Red Road to Sobriety meetings have been rescheduled, according to a notice from the Paiute Indian Tribe of Utah.

While the meeting on Wednesday, Sept. 2, was set for the usual time of 5 p.m., subsequent meetings will follow a new schedule.

Starting Sept. 10 and moving forward, meetings will be held on Thursdays at 11 a.m.

Meetings are held at the PITU Admin Building and are also available online via a link or QR code provided on a flyer.
